What is a Commission LPN in Radiology?

Commission LPNs in Radiology are Licensed Practical Nurses who work specifically within radiology departments or imaging centers, often on a commission or contract basis rather than as full-time staff. Their duties include assisting radiologists, preparing patients for imaging procedures, administering medications, and ensuring patient safety during diagnostic tests. They play a crucial role in patient care and procedural support in radiology settings, combining clinical nursing skills with knowledge of imaging processes.

How does a Commission LPN in Radiology typically collaborate with radiologists and other healthcare team members during diagnostic procedures?

As a Commission LPN in Radiology, you play a crucial support role during diagnostic imaging procedures. You will work closely with radiologists, technologists, and nurses, assisting with patient preparation, monitoring vital signs, and ensuring patient comfort and safety. Good communication and teamwork are essential, as you'll often need to coordinate care, relay patient information, and respond quickly to changes in patient status. This collaborative environment helps ensure that procedures run smoothly and patients receive high-quality care.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Commission LPN in Radiology,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Commission LPN in Radiology, you need a valid LPN license, strong understanding of nursing fundamentals, and familiarity with radiologic procedures. Experience with radiology-specific electronic health records (EHRs), patient positioning equipment, and compliance with safety protocols is typically required. Excellent communication, attention to detail, and the ability to provide compassionate care are standout soft skills in this role. These competencies are essential for ensuring patient safety, supporting radiology teams, and maintaining accurate documentation in a specialized clinical environment.

Your Impact:
โ€ข Administer prescribed medications and accurately document patient care
โ€ข Assess patients prior to dosing and monitor patient well-being
โ€ข Perform medication inventory, reconciliation, and controlled substance accountability
โ€ข Obtain vital signs, TB testing, and other clinical assessments
โ€ข Assist the Medical Director with patient evaluations and scheduling
โ€ข Maintain confidential electronic medical records
โ€ข Support CARF accreditation and regulatory compliance
โ€ข Deliver exceptional customer service while assisting patients and visitors
โ€ข Collaborate with physicians, nurses, and counselors to provide high-quality, compassionate care

Qualifications:
โ€ข Active North Carolina Licensed Practical Nurse (LPN) license
โ€ข Minimum of 1 year of direct patient care experience
โ€ข Strong clinical assessment and medication administration skills
โ€ข Excellent communication and customer service abilities
โ€ข Computer proficiency, including Microsoft Office
โ€ข Experience in outpatient nursing, behavioral health, addiction medicine, family practice, corrections, primary care, or community health is preferred but not required
